Meeting notes — Records team sync, Thursday

Attendees: records team, payroll liaison.

Main item: payslip delivery for the Farrowfield packing site, which still has no printer. Agreed that payroll will print and seal all payslips at the Westmoor office on the Tuesday before payday. The records team will log envelope counts against the staff roster before dispatch and retain a copy of the manifest for six months. A courier from Quillgate Express handles the run each cycle. The hand-over instruction for the courier is noted below.

handover note for yagef-bagep: the drudor pelius courier leaves the kasdor zorvan norir ledger at gate 8016 under passcode 755406

Firmware releases for the Cobblet Hub ship through the "stable" and "canary" channels. Promote builds only after the Verrano lab signs off. Channel assignments live in the rollout database; the updater polls it every ten minutes, so changes propagate fast. Never edit channel rows during an active rollout. To inspect or promote a build, connect to the rollout database directly using the connection string below.

primary connection of yagep-kahip = redis://giliel_svc:zYiKsLL2PLpfPL@db-348f.xolmarsys.corp:5432/fenwyn

## Further reading

Pedalshift rebalances dock inventory across the Kestrelport bike-share network every 20 minutes. If you're on call, you mainly care about the solver timeout alarm and the stale-telemetry alarm. Both are covered in the ops guide, along with manual rebalance steps and truck-dispatch overrides. Start with the architecture overview on the internal page.

operations page: https://jira.qorvelsys.internal/browse/pages/browse/pages

Ticket: Firmware channel drift on Lanternook fleet

The Pemberline gateway devices in the Varsk depot are pulling firmware from the beta channel while the manifest says stable. This drifted after the October rollback and was never reconciled. Future maintainers: always verify the channel pin before approving OTA waves. For reference, the intended values as approved by the platform board are as follows.

deployment values, faduf-tawep:
SORDOR_LOG_LEVEL=error
SORDOR_METRICS_HOST=metrics.sordor.nelvrolabs.internal
SORDOR_POOL_SIZE=4